Broad Run Contractor Comparison Points

Use these checks when comparing HVAC contractors serving Broad Run.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.

  • Request maintenance plan terms separately from the repair or replacement quote.
  • Confirm whether ductwork, thermostat wiring, drain lines, and permits are included.
  • Compare seer2, hspf2, warranty length, and labor coverage instead of equipment price alone.
  • Ask whether the estimate includes a load calculation for replacements.
  •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Permit and code workElectrical, venting, drain, platform, and disconnect updates may be outside the base equipment price.Which code or permit items are included in writing?
Labor warrantyManufacturer parts coverage is different from contractor labor coverage.How long is labor covered, and what maintenance is required?
Load calculationReplacement equipment should be sized to the home, not only matched to the old unit.Will the estimate include a Manual J or documented load calculation?
Duct and airflowDuct restrictions, returns, filters, and static pressure can affect comfort after the repair.Did the quote include airflow checks and ductwork assumptions?

When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Broad Run

Call sooner when you see

  • Refrigerant-line icing, major water overflow, or a system that repeatedly shuts down.
  • Burning smell, electrical arcing, repeated breaker trips, or water near electrical components.
  • No heat during freezing conditions or no cooling during dangerous heat.

Plan ahead for

  • Duct, thermostat, or zoning upgrades when comfort problems are recurring.
  • Replacement planning for older systems before peak-season demand.
  • Maintenance before the first heavy heating or cooling period.

What size HVAC system do I need for my Broad Run home?

HVAC sizing depends on home square footage, insulation, and local climate. A Broad Run HVAC professional can perform a load calculation to determine the right size for your home.

Can HVAC cause allergy problems in Broad Run?

Yes, dirty HVAC systems can circulate allergens. Regular filter changes, duct cleaning, and maintenance help improve indoor air quality in Broad Run homes.

Should I repair or replace my HVAC in Broad Run?

Consider replacement if your Broad Run HVAC is over 15 years old, requires frequent repairs, or if repair costs exceed 50% of replacement cost. A local technician can advise.

What is a HVAC tune-up and what does it include?

An HVAC tune-up in Broad Run ($86-$229) includes inspection, cleaning, filter change, refrigerant check, electrical testing, and performance verification.
